What is Rose Gold?

A popular metal in bygone eras, rose gold is an alloy. Its pinkish hue is a result of pure gold being mixed with copper (and occasionally, a small amount of silver).

What Gems Pair Best With Rose Gold?

Diamonds will always look timeless in a rose gold engagement ring. If you’re searching for something with a bit more color, we suggest pearls, morganite, emerald, or sapphire.

What’s the Best Setting for a Rose Gold Engagement Ring?

There is no “best” setting for a rose gold ring, as it all depends on your partner’s personal style. Popular choices include the subtle solitaire, the extra glamorous halo, or something vintage-inspired, like a French cut basket.

Should You Wait to Buy Your Wedding Band?

Unless you know your bride wants a pre-designed matching ring set, we recommend waiting until after she’s said yes to look for wedding bands. This shopping trip can occur anywhere from three to six months before the big day.
